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8952190 153 0942673829 73677161
871851826 9023268
871851826 9023268
54523753369 1846025 849191478
All about undefined
Interested in learning more?
871851826 9023268
54523753369 1846025 849191478
See more
26 62723217931 60447
047508 659 22762
See more
30457557 350806080 51594929872
65 11815771 33
See more